Comprehensive Service Overview

In Midland, roofing work for residences and businesses typically begins with detailed inspections to identify issues like cracks, missing granules, or storm impacts. Homeowners often value photo-documented reports that clearly show problems and targeted repair options, helping decisions without surprises.

Repairs focus on stopping water intrusion quickly, using proven sealants and flashing upgrades suited to local winds. For full replacements, common materials include asphalt shingles for affordability and metal panels for superior durability against hail and snow—both installed with enhanced ventilation to prevent ice buildup.

Commercial projects might involve flat or low-slope roofs with modified bitumen or TPO membranes, emphasizing seamless edges and drainage. Regional approaches account for prairie exposure: robust underlayment, ice-and-water shields, and secure fastening patterns.

Expect attention to clean job sites, property protection during work, and workmanship details that support long-term performance. While specifics vary, South Dakota's conditions shape a focus on resilience over flash.

Regional Characteristics

Midland nestles in South Dakota's vast plains, where housing mixes vintage single-family homes on large lots with scattered commercial buildings and agricultural outbuildings. The climate is unforgiving: high winds year-round, heavy snowfall in winter, intense summer sun, and storm risks. Low-density development means roofs cover expansive, exposed structures, often requiring reinforcements for snow weight and gusts up to 70 mph.

Terrain is flat to gently rolling, influencing straightforward access but demanding wind-secure installations. Many homes date to mid-20th century, with updates focusing on energy efficiency amid rising utility costs.

Common Issues

Homeowners here frequently spot shingles lifted by wind, ice dams causing leaks, and hail dents after spring storms. Gradual granule loss from UV exposure and poor attic ventilation leading to moisture buildup are typical in older roofs. Commercial flat roofs may face ponding water, while rural properties deal with debris accumulation from open fields.
